Meet Apostroph the 'Possum-a charming little traveler on a mission to bring words and phrases together across the globe!

Step into a whimsical journey with Apostroph, where punctuation, family, friendship, and world languages connect in delightful ways.

In this book, you will:

  • Discover how learning about apostrophes can be an exciting journey.
  • Meet Apostroph's twin sister, Okina, who lives in Hawaii.
  • Find joy in helping others communicate.
  • Explore the beauty of geography, different cultures, and world languages.
  • Embrace the value of family time, no matter the distance.
  • Appreciate the humble Apostroph's role in linking words and people alike.

More than a lesson about contractions, Apostroph the 'Possum: I Simply Can't Not is a heartfelt story about communication, culture and connection, turning learning about apostrophes into an unforgettable adventure. Dive into the heart of language, love, and laughter today.

Jones, Brian G.: - A Carnegie Mellon University graduate and native of Washington, DC, Brian began designing exhibits for the Smithsonian Institution, the world's largest museum, education, and research complex. His artwork includes sculpture, silkscreen, wood carvings, painting, illustrations, graphic design, and more! His work has been exhibited throughout the DC area, and New York State, with recognition from Print Magazine and the American Institute of Graphic Arts (AIGA). In his spare time, he enjoys working on projects with his little sister. He currently teaches in the Communication Design department at City University of New York for the College of Technology in Brooklyn, NY. He and his wife live in Manhattan, NY.Metallo, Alysia: - Alysia was born and raised in Washington, DC, and is a pianist, singer/songwriter, and teacher. She is also a polyglot. (That means she speaks several languages!) She studied music at Catholic University of America and Howard University and studied world languages at the University of Madrid, Spain. She continued her studies in teaching at the University of Santiago de Compostela, Spain. In her spare time, she enjoys songwriting, and working on projects with her older brother, Brian. She is excited to be able to present this book as her first in a series of children's books that are educational and entertaining. She lives in Northern, VA with her husband and their three daughters.
